Open Campuses Create a Distinct Security Challenge

Protect an Environment Built for Access, Learning and Collaboration

Universities support thousands of students, faculty, employees, researchers, guests and third parties across changing devices, shared facilities, public applications and distributed networks. That openness is essential to education—and attractive to attackers.

CampusSecure gives institutional IT teams a focused security operating model that addresses the most common technical and human risks without forcing the institution to build every specialist capability in-house.

A SIEM Platform Is More Valuable When Skilled Eyes Are Watching

CampusSecure connects institutional security data to a focused monitoring workflow. CyberAxis helps keep the SIEM healthy, improves signal quality and adds vSOC expertise to review, triage and escalate priority alerts.

  • Campus log sources
  • SIEM collection and correlation
  • Use cases and tuned alerts
  • vSOC triage and investigation
  • Escalation to the campus IT team
